The size of Koonawarra is approximately 2.2 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 26.9% of total area. The population of Koonawarra in 2011 was 3,633 people. By 2016 the population was 3,645 showing a population growth of 0.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Koonawarra is 0-9 years. Households in Koonawarra are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Koonawarra work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 58.9% of the homes in Koonawarra were owner-occupied compared with 55.6% in 2016.
